Output 16a59cc186b60b90e181b841120429803262aa4e1bcf3305811c984018b7395a:1

value
1108105
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c80ad17e18616c4de194d914d8686635ff78327f OP_EQUALVERIFY OP_CHECKSIG
address
1KEj738yBnbuvufkAK43BaW7sEyhNbRifr
transaction
16a59cc186b60b90e181b841120429803262aa4e1bcf3305811c984018b7395a
confirmations
248811
spent
true